DESCRIPTION
The UTC
UM1671
is a low voltage operating 75Ω driver,
operating supply voltage from 2.8V to 5.5V. Including a
high-performance 4-order LPF, a available output gain built-in amp
and a sag auxiliary circuit, etc.
The UTC
UM1671
is suitable for video signal output in devices
ranging from portable equipment such as digital still cameras to
stationary equipment such as DVD players.

Note: Absolute maximum ratings are those values beyond which the device could be permanently damaged.
Absolute maximum ratings are stress ratings only and functional device operation is not implied.
